Daily scale check could keep heart patients out of hospital

NCT ID NCT05098665

Summary

This study tests whether having patients with cardiac amyloidosis (a serious heart condition) monitor their weight daily at home can help prevent hospital admissions. When weight increases indicate fluid buildup, doctors will contact patients to adjust medications. Researchers will compare this remote monitoring approach to standard care in 320 patients to see if it reduces hospital visits and improves outcomes.
